Preparing for Antidepressant Tapering: Essential Steps

Antidepressant tapering refers to the gradual reduction of medication dosage over time to safely discontinue treatment. This process is medically necessary because antidepressants modify neurotransmitter levels in the brain, particularly serotonin, norepinephrine, and dopamine. Abrupt cessation can result in discontinuation syndrome, characterized by physical and psychological symptoms.
